Description

Adecco Saskatoon is currently recruiting for a
full time permanent senior Seismic Surveyor job on
behalf of our client. Our client primarily
provides seismic services to companies in the oil
and gas industry. The surveyor will act as the
project lead on all projects and developments and
ensure that projects are completed within a
specific deadline. This role will involve frequent
travel primarily in Saskatchewan and Alberta The
ideal candidate should have a minimum three to
five years of experience in the geophysical
industry and must be skilled with Seismic GPS.
Salary for this position will be commensurate with
experience and education.

Responsibilities for the Seismic Surveyor Job will
include;
-Provide supervision to seismic surveyors
-Manage day to day operations in the field while
providing quality control, identifying problems
and creating solutions
-Ensure HSE standards for all members of the team
-Develop new techniques and tools with developing
technologies
-Ensure clients receive products in a timely
manner that exceed expectations
-Lead both 2D and 3D surveys and data analysis
-Communicate project progress to General Manager

Qualifications include;
-Minimum three to five years of experience in the
geophysical industry
-Minimum of one to three years experience working
on 2D and/or 3D processing projects
-Technical degree or other a post secondary
diploma in survey technology will be an asset
-Proven success in generating and cultivating new
clients
-Saskatchewan Licensed land surveyor or other
provincially eligible land surveyors are ideal
-Willingness to work long hours, travel to field
and customer locations as needed
-Ability to effectively work both independently
and as part of a team
-Valid driver license
